Delimara Transmitter

The Delimara Transmitter was a relay station of Deutsche Welle near Cyclops on Malta.

The short wave antennas were mounted on free-standing lattice towers.

Originally, the medium wave antenna consisted of three masts, each 88 metres tall, but at one mast one (Parafil) guy melted as a result of the high electric field values halfway up from the anchor point.

Unfortunately there was also a storm at this time, which resulted in mast collapse.
